Secret Features to Look For During a Treadmill Sale
When an appealing discount rate appears, it is easy to make an impulse buy. However, a low-cost treadmill is no deal if it does not meet the user's specific physical fitness needs. Buyers should examine the following requirements before shooting on any sale item:
1. Motor Power (CHP)
The motor is the heart of any motorized treadmill. Continuous Horsepower (CHP) determines the motor's capability to maintain continual power in time.
- 2.0 to 2.5 CHP: Suitable for strolling and light jogging for users of average weight.
- 3.0 CHP: Ideal for regular joggers and runners who plan to utilize the device numerous times a week.
- 3.5 CHP and greater: Necessary for severe marathon training, heavy use, or families with multiple users.
2. Running Deck Size
The dimensions of the belt determine comfort and safety throughout an exercise.
- Walking: A belt length of 45 to 50 inches and a width of 16 to 18 inches is generally sufficient.
- Running: Taller runners or those with long strides require a minimum belt length of 55 to 60 inches and a width of 20 inches to prevent stepping off the edge.
3. Cushioning Systems

4. Incline and Decline Capabilities
A slope adds variety and strength, mimicking uphill outside running to burn more calories and engage different muscle groups. Some premium designs also include a decrease function for downhill training.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Are reconditioned or open-box treadmills worth buying throughout a sale?
Yes, purchasing a licensed refurbished or open-box treadmill from a credible producer can conserve 20% to 40% off retail prices. Simply ensure the system includes a genuine manufacturer's warranty to protect against potential mechanical failures.
How much space do I require for a home treadmill?
As a general rule, purchasers must allocate an area roughly 3 feet wide by 6 to 7 feet long for the machine itself, plus an additional 3 to 4 feet of clearance behind the treadmill sales for safety in case of a trip or fall. Those with minimal space ought to specifically try to find folding treadmills with hydraulic drop-assist systems.

How often do I need to lube the treadmill belt?
Many contemporary treadmills require belt lubrication every 3 to 6 months, depending on use frequency. Keeping the belt effectively oiled decreases friction, extends the life of the motor, Treadmill Price and guarantees a smooth running experience.
